Output f81fc5af8459381688332c401cbcd5ad305cec38b722706f41f414dc759a37b5:1

value
546300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80664b3a78c6e0128b9bec9eea81181e6bdfc6a3 OP_EQUAL
address
3DPvxbm2HMLR9uYn2eectDVvJNDaNoVNQ7
transaction
f81fc5af8459381688332c401cbcd5ad305cec38b722706f41f414dc759a37b5
confirmations
227438
spent
true